Divine Dwelling Ancient Deep Pool
Overview
Kamui Kotan is, in the Ainu language, meaning "Village of Gods", and is a scenic spot where strange rocks and grotesque rocks continue for approximately 10km along the rapids of the Ishikari River.
The valley's dark green and blackish rocks are called Kamui Kotan Stone, and also, in the suspension bridge's vicinity, there is the "Kamui Kotan Pothole Group" which the torrent creates, <in Shōwa 41 (1966), city's natural monument designation>.
